In order to make it look like it was floating I used the round, soft shapes. In the final piece I chose to go with the wave, instead of the closed shape.
When someone is feeling blue they’re feeling emotions like depression, sadness, emptiness, confusion, down, unhappy etc. I chose to go with the color blue since I think that described it the best.
I was thinking about how I could illustrate a threat in the same time using all the collected information together but that was hard. In the shape that's closed you could see a mysterious shape or object that you can't really tell what it might be.
Corona is very often described as the invisible enemy. It's the invisible threat you can't control.
That is what I tried to create.
In the end result, I didn't want to use the closed shape because I wanted to use the wave instead. But it does remind of something that's invisible too, I'm thinking that it might be a ghost? The invisible enemy, the invisible threat. But when adding all the reflections together I thought that the wave was the one to go for.

These are my imitations of the hands that are opening a package/breaking loose/breaking free.
Tried to make it as abstract as I possibly could but by keeping the basic shape of the hands.
The two smaller stripes are meant to symbolize space.
"Breaking loose in order to get your own space" was something I had in mind while doing this abstract illustration. When I thought about breaking loose I instantly thought about someone that's fighting for their freedom. A pair of hands with chains trying to break loose in order to achieve the freedom they deserve. After this thought something else came to my mind and it was someone that is trying to open a package with their hands. They are also breaking something in order to achieve something. Something good.
